Scored a Partagas 150 the other day in a trade. It's the domestic kind, not Cuban. I'm under the impression that it's a rather rare cigar, and possibly worth a bit of money. Other than that, I have no idea when they were made, if they were a limited run, if you can still find them, etc....

Please enlighten me! I estimate this cigar's size at 6.5" x 46-47rg.

Released in 1995 (and again in 2005 + renamed the 160) by General Cigars to celebrate the 150th anniversary of the Partagas brand.

I've read where these are an OK smoke. The wrapper is very fragile and the flavors are quite delicate.

Very light cigar. I have seven sticks left from a box, and on occasion you'll be able to find them in a shop still, but usually way over priced. Smoke em now, because they are getting lighter and lighter every year. They are very enjoyable if you can appreciate light cigars, and if you are a full bodied guy you may not see the appeal.
